1907 Map of Bessemer Special

USGS Topo · Published 1907

This historical map portrays the area of Bessemer Special in 1907, primarily covering Jefferson County as well as portions of Shelby County. Featuring a scale of 1:62500, this map provides a highly detailed snapshot of the terrain, roads, buildings, counties, and historical landmarks in the Bessemer Special region at the time. Published in 1907, it is one of 4 known editions of this map due to revisions or reprints.
